On this day
73 YEARS AGO (1945)
Our front page declared UK and US scientists had harnessed “the basic power of the universe” – atomic energy in the form of a bomb – to hit Japan.
42 YEARS AGO (1976)
NASA’s Viking 2 went into orbit around Mars as part of its mission to send back photographs of suitable landing sites.
31 YEARS AGO (1987)
American Lynne Cox, 30, became the first person to swim across the 2.7-mile Bering Strait between the US and the Soviet Union.
